Hi Gonzalo recon-all -s <subject> -balabels
should do the trick cheers Bruce On Fri, 15 Nov 2013, Gonzalo Rojas Costa wrote: > > Hi: > > I have some freesurfer processed studies.... I used 5.1 version, and now I > found that it don't has the brodmann area labels and statistics generated in > some studies...
